Mastering Time Zones for Seamless Salesforce Development and Collaboration
Effectively work together with colleagues across diverse time zones is paramount in today's global Salesforce development landscape. Implement strategic practices to mitigate time zone challenges and foster seamless teamwork. A key step involves aligning schedules through readily accessible platforms. Clearly specify meeting times in universal time formats like UTC to guarantee global comprehension. Cultivate a culture of flexibility to accommodate varied working hours and promote inclusivity within your development team.
- Leverage Salesforce's built-in time zone features for consistent data representation across all regions.
- Schedule meetings with due consideration for overlapping work hours to maximize participation.
- Promote open communication channels to resolve any time zone-related ambiguities promptly.
Leveraging Time-Zone Overlap for Efficient Offshore Salesforce Teams
To maximize the effectiveness of offshore Salesforce teams, carefully designing time-zone overlap is crucial. A strategically overlap facilitates seamless collaboration, prompt issue resolution, and efficient knowledge sharing. By coordinating work schedules across time zones, teams can attain a consistent workflow, leading to increased productivity and customer satisfaction.
- Evaluate the specific roles and responsibilities of each team member.
- Determine core work hours that require overlap for effective collaboration.
- Utilize communication tools and platforms that facilitate real-time interaction across time zones.
- Encourage a culture of clear communication and regular check-ins to mitigate any potential communication barriers.
